Hurricane Milton's Devastation
This chapter assesses the catastrophic impact of Hurricane Milton on Florida, detailing its landfall and the immediate destruction wrought by 180 mph winds. It further explores the emotional responses of meteorologists as well as the implications of climate change on hurricane intensity and frequency. The chapter also examines the historical and financial complexities of hurricane preparedness and insurance in the U.S., posing important questions about disaster recovery responsibilities.
